Output 3cf913ecca28ca425f916566f80546c102f00aa5e2149329955f7d4f99d12088:3

value
55455802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c21ee51e8bbc270a06dd4638dc83f51ba4348814 OP_EQUAL
address
MRbaLGTaRu7HbLhvKUaVCeJMpTKEv6ujLy
transaction
3cf913ecca28ca425f916566f80546c102f00aa5e2149329955f7d4f99d12088
spent
true